Due to continued expansion, Burtons Medical Equipment is looking to recruit a Field Service Engineer to join our growing team. In this role, you will be responsible for the installation, servicing, repair, and commissioning of our wide range of equipment at customer locations within your designated region. As this is a field-based position, applicants must be located within the service area. The successful candidate will deliver excellent customer service, building strong relationships with clients while ensuring equipment is maintained and operating to the highest standards.

Burtons Medical Equipment is a leading supplier of veterinary equipment within the animal healthcare sector. With over 40 years of industry experience, we manufacture, supply, and support a broad range of products across the UK, Ireland, and international markets. Our team of more than 200 employees is dedicated to delivering outstanding after-sales support.
